Output ec66796075d62f39b28dc8964a84629ea9ea7a947ec01ca874ff79ac55f663e5:0

value
416278
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4171c7401d89e3b5d74161b3e6829dcd07e5c74f OP_EQUALVERIFY OP_CHECKSIG
address
16y3Dvg15uqaovmMmdK2MZjE4WYXGvhDSK
transaction
ec66796075d62f39b28dc8964a84629ea9ea7a947ec01ca874ff79ac55f663e5
confirmations
170844
spent
true